The Musical Temperament

Psychology and Personality of Musicians

The Musical Temperament( )
Author: Kemp, Anthony E.
ISBN:978-0-19-852362-8
Publication Date:Jul 1996
Publisher:Oxford University Press, Incorporated
Book Format:Paperback
List Price:USD $125.00
Book Description:

It is generally accepted that exceptionally skilled people in society, such as airline pilots and brain surgeons, have significantly different personalities from those of the general population. A kind of folklore has long existed within musical circles that there are fundamental personality differences between the players of different instruments. Dr Kemp examines this fascinating issue, as well as several others relating to the musical temperament, in the light of his ten years of...
